Dear Anon, 1. Before actually answering your question, I think you first need to know about the difference between the 20-year, yearly and monthly. a. 20-year Base Star - Gives you the permanent influence of that sector depending on when your house was built. b. Yearly Star - Gives you the influence of the Yearly star changes which only impacts that particular year. c. Monthly Star - Gives you the influence of the Monthly star changes which impacts that month. Once you understand this, you will then know that priority is to always fix up the 20-year base star as this impacts the long term. The Yearly only shift some luck slightly for the better or worst. Dear Hoa Luong, The report you generated is for the 20 year Flying Star for period 7. However, the Year 2003 report is based on this year, thus the difference. One should look at the 20 year Flying Star numbers first and relate it to (any additional adverse stars of the Year 2003) which may make the sector worse-off. For example, for a South-West house at 240 degrees, the 20 year Flying Star for Period 7 are as follows:- #3 mountain #2 water with base #5 and Year 4 while for North is #5 mountain with #9 water and base #3.
